Output fc66f5974deceb0773dc4c83bbbe553e4c24e1370acf016feea01ef8f944f89c:32

value
4874662
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1966e5222885ab9852155bd7d7f03788a46fe8ad OP_EQUALVERIFY OP_CHECKSIG
address
13KKA52GEqeWxHX4JfjQftHfkqgyv7oBie
transaction
fc66f5974deceb0773dc4c83bbbe553e4c24e1370acf016feea01ef8f944f89c
confirmations
624132
spent
true